| Cur Síos: | Malignant pleural effusion is a common complication of cancer, this entity represents a therapeutic challenge as the survival of patients with the disease is usually limited. We present the first reported case in Costa Rica of a PleurX® catheter insertion for symptomatic malignant pleural effusion management in a patient previously treated with multiple thoracenteses. This device is a new therapeutic alternative in Costa Rica for the treatment of this serious complication associated with a limited life prognosis and impaired quality of life. |
